Output 43cba3291f1e28c29a6ab321f87c6624ec1ab7a31d52f17e72f25087117002c0:1

value
107025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 829bcb19a29531606c25b22ce9a67a4b3fcf676d OP_EQUAL
address
3DbcQCDHkgPCuvUXaevSD6dpbQi56rBNWZ
transaction
43cba3291f1e28c29a6ab321f87c6624ec1ab7a31d52f17e72f25087117002c0